Hüseyin Akbulut is the founder of Sporeus and author of THRESHOLD (EŞİK), a 540-page Turkish-language book on endurance science. He holds a Master's degree in Sport Sciences and writes for Sporeus on exercise physiology, endurance training, and human performance science, drawing on the peer-reviewed literature and over five years of editorial work in the field.
